微信小程式後台管理系統的PHP開發要點

WBOY
發布: 2023-06-01 11:42:01
原創
2690 人瀏覽過

隨著微信小程式的普及,越來越多的企業和個人開始使用微信小程式為自己的業務服務,甚至已經成為了許多公司的主要行銷方式之一。微信小程式的便利性和高用戶黏度,使得越來越多的業務系統都需要開發小程式版本。而隨著小程式的開發增多,其後台管理系統的研究和開發也成為了不可或缺的一環。本文將介紹微信小程式後台管理系統的開發要點,特別是針對其PHP開發過程中的注意事項與技巧。

一、後台管理系統的功能需求

在開發微信小程式後台管理系統之前,首先需要先明確其功能需求。微信小程式後台管理系統作為一個管理小程式的系統,其主要功能包括小程式管理、使用者管理、內容管理、資料分析和多層級權限管理等,以下具體介紹:

  1. 小程式管理:管理員可以在後台管理系統中新增、刪除、編輯小程式的基本信息,並能夠查看小程式的使用情況,如使用者數量、活躍度等。
  2. 使用者管理:管理員可以查看小程式的使用者列表,並且能夠對使用者進行管理,例如新增、刪除、停用等。
  3. 內容管理:管理員可以管理小程式的各類內容,如發布新聞、活動資訊、廣告等,並且能夠編輯、刪除、審核等。
  4. 資料分析:管理員可以透過後台管理系統進行資料分析,了解小程式的使用者狀況、使用情況、使用者行為等,以便進行精準的行銷推廣。
  5. 多層權限管理:管理員可以設定不同的權限等級,以便其他人員能夠在背景管理系統中進行部分管理工作,但不能進行一些敏感、重要操作。

二、後台管理系統的技術架構

在針對微信小程式後台管理系統的PHP開發中,其技術架構主要包括三個面向:前端、後端、資料庫.

  1. 前端技術:微信小程式後台管理系統的前端主要採用Vue.js、Element UI、Echarts等相關的技術進行開發。其中,Vue.js是一種輕量級的JavaScript框架,可協助我們建立使用者介面;Element UI是一套基於Vue.js的元件庫,可用於快速建立頁面;Echarts是一款資料視覺化程式庫,可幫助我們進行數據分析和展示。
  2. 後端技術:微信小程式後台管理系統的後端主要採用PHP、ThinkPHP、MySQL等相關技術進行開發。其中,PHP是一種流行的伺服器端腳本語言,能夠連接資料庫、產生HTML等;ThinkPHP是一套基於PHP的開源Web應用開發框架,能夠快速開發高品質的Web應用;MySQL則是一款流行的關係型資料庫管理系統,廣泛使用於各種Web應用中。
  3. 資料庫技術:本文所使用的資料庫為MySQL,設計資料庫時,需要依照實際業務需求設計相關的資料表,包括使用者表、文章表、評論表、權限表等。

三、後台管理系統的開發流程

在開發微信小程式後台管理系統的PHP流程中,我們可以依照下列步驟進行開發:

  1. 建置環境:在開發之前,我們需要先安裝並設定相關環境,如PHP、Apache/Nginx、MySQL、Vue.js、Element UI等。
  2. 設計資料庫:根據實際業務需求,設計相關的資料表結構,並建立對應的資料表。
  3. 後端介面開發:依照業務需求,開發相關的後端接口,包括使用者接口、文章接口、評論接口等;同時,需要確保接口的安全性,如使用者驗證、權限控制等。
  4. 前端介面開發:依照UI設計稿,開發相關的前端介面,包括登入介面、首頁、使用者管理介面、文章管理介面、評論管理介面等,同時需要根據業務需求進行邏輯開發。
  5. 聯調測試:進行前後端聯調測試,確認系統的正常運作。

四、開發注意事項

在微信小程式後台管理系統的開發過程中,需要注意以下幾點:

  1. 後端介面開發需盡量安全,可採用JWT等技術對介面進行權限控制,以確保資料的安全性。
  2. 介面開發需要根據UI設計稿進行,同時要注意介面的美觀性和易用性,使得使用者能夠輕鬆上手。
  3. 使用前端框架時,需要了解其基本使用方法和原理,避免開發過程中出現問題。同時,開發初期需要與前後端團隊溝通合作,共同製定開發標準與規範。
  4. 資料庫的設計要合理,需要根據實際業務需求進行設計,確保系統資料的完整性和一致性。

五、總結

#

微信小程式後台管理系統的開發是一個較為複雜的項目,需要針對不同的業務需求進行設計和開發。在PHP開發過程中,開發團隊需要充分了解技術架構和開發流程,並不斷優化開發過程中的技術細節和開發模式,確保開發效率和開發品質的兼顧。同時,也需要靈活應對各種出現的問題,投入足夠的時間和精力進行測試優化。只有這樣,我們才能夠開發出高品質、高效率的微信小程式後台管理系統。

以上是微信小程式後台管理系統的PHP開發要點的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
最新問題
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板